Job Description

Introduction

We are currently hiring an EHS Manager for our client, a global pharmaceutical company and one of the largest pharmaceutical companies in the world. The company is known for its global contribution in areas including pharmaceuticals and consumer healthcare products.

Responsibilities

  • Secure site license to operate in compliance with all Health, Safety and Environment regulations and permits
  • Liaise with external legal authorities and local stakeholders to avoid administrative notices
  • Ensure full compliance with local, provincial and federal EHS and security regulations and standards
  • Serve as primary EHS contact for regulatory authorities and certification bodies
  • Coordinate site risk assessments and implement risk mitigation processes for administrative, injury, environmental and reputational hazards
  • Allocate capex, opex and headcount resources to address major site risks
  • Build and maintain EHS management system aligned with corporate requirements and digital core model
  • Support global certification initiatives and ensure accuracy of consolidated EHS data reporting
  • Define and drive continuous improvement plan based on site-specific risks
  • Prepare and lead regular EHS management reviews at site level and with senior management
  • Establish and maintain robust EHS governance framework across all site operations
  • Promote proactive EHS culture through training, education and targeted programs for all employees
  • Provide in-depth EHS expertise and coaching to integrate safety and environmental considerations into projects
  • Manage capture, investigation, mitigation and reporting of all EHS events to prevent recurrence
  • Lead local EHS emergency response and crisis management activities
  • Oversee EHS operational activities and manage site EHS team, including hiring, training, coaching, and performance evaluation

Requirements

  • Bachelor’s degree in Life Sciences, Engineering or related discipline required
  • Minimum 10 years of relevant experience, including at least 5 years in EHS management
  • Proficiency in occupational hygiene, safety, environmental expertise, product stewardship and security
  • Strong background in management systems, regulatory knowledge, matrix and project management
  • Demonstrated strategic thinking, organizational change management and influencing skills
  • Proven direct and transversal management capabilities
  • Fluent in English, written and spoken
  • Coach and develop teams to drive EHS transformation, inspire and motivate stakeholders, and foster cross-functional collaboration
  • Make timely, data-driven decisions in fast-moving, complex environments to optimize site performance
  • Supervise and monitor compliance with employment, health, safety and regulatory legislation, partnering with Joint Health and Safety Committee
  • Lead investigation of incidents and work-related illnesses, respond promptly to concerns with thorough documentation
  • Implement and enforce reasonable precautions, protective equipment use, and hazard communication to ensure staff health and safety
